Equal Opportunity Employer
State Bank of India (CA) (“SBIC”) is committed to providing equal employment opportunities for all applicants and employees without regard to race (including, but not limited to, hair texture and protective hairstyles. Protective hairstyles include, but are not limited to hairstyles such as braids, locks, and twists), religious creed, color, national origin (includes language use and possession of a driver’s license issued to persons unable to prove their presence in the United States is authorized under federal law), age, ancestry, marital status, military and veteran status, sex/ gender(includes pregnancy, childbirth, breastfeeding and/or related medical conditions), gender identity, gender expression, sexual orientation, disability (physical or mental), medical condition (cancer or record history of cancer), genetic information, reproductive health decision making, exercising the right to any legally provided leave of absence, status as a Vietnam era veteran or qualified disabled, recently separated, and armed forces service medal veteran as defined by applicable federal and state laws, or any other classification protected under state or federal law or stats as a Vietnam era veteran or qualified disabled veteran as defined by applicable federal and state laws (“Protected Characteristics”).
Our goal is to create and foster an inclusive work environment that values diversity and is free of discrimination and harassment. The Bank is committed to recruiting, hiring, training, and promoting qualified individuals in all job titles, as well as ensuring that all other personnel actions are administered without regard to the Protected Characteristics. All employment decisions are based on valid job requirements or other legitimate non-discriminatory reasons. We will ensure that employees and applicants are not subject to unlawful harassment.
Reasonable Accommodation
SBIC is committed to complying with all applicable provisions of the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). It is the Bank’s policy not to discriminate against any qualified employee or applicant regarding any terms or conditions of employment because of such individual’s disability or perceived disability so long as the employee can perform the essential functions of the job. The Bank will provide reasonable accommodations to a qualified individual with a disability, as defined by the ADA, who has made the Bank aware of a disability, provided such accommodation does not constitute an undue hardship to the Bank.
